About the Session

In an era where AI-generated code is accelerating delivery, quality can no longer be treated as a final checkpoint. Instead, it must be embedded, intentional, and governed.

In this session, Alekhya Guduri presents a blueprint for building a modern QA organization that operates as a strategic business function. You’ll learn how to shift from centralized testing teams to shared ownership models, while introducing guardrails that ensure responsible AI use across the delivery pipeline.

From defining a Materiality Matrix to identify where AI risks are too high to ignore, to implementing Human-in-the-Loop frameworks, this talk provides actionable guidance for leaders navigating AI-driven engineering environments.


Key Takeaways

  • The Materiality Matrix: How to objectively prioritize AI risks based on business impact and technical complexity
  • Distributed Governance: Transitioning from centralized QA to shared ownership in AI-driven CI/CD pipelines
  • Responsible AI Guardrails: Practical Human-in-the-Loop frameworks to prevent bias, hallucinations, and silent failures
  • Strategic Automation: A realistic view of what AI can automate today-and where human intuition remains critical
